Agartala April 7: State BJP President Rajib Bhattacharjee  demanded that Congress and CPIM make an unholy alliance and raise it before the people. In a press conference held at the BJP office in the state on Sunday afternoon, he fired at the Congress and the CPI(M) and said that the country is not big for the Congress, their aim is to divide the country and the people. Their party is governed by such policies.

Due to which many Congress leaders had to migrate to Bharatiya Janata Party. He also said that there is no evaluation of workers within the Congress. Leaders want to save their own interests. After coming to the Bharatiya Janata Party, he went back to the Congress. Actually they have no guarantee. This is the manifestation of their character. Due to which they have reached single digits in the last assembly elections. This was said by the state BJP President, taking a jibe at Mr. Burman and Mr. Saha.

Taking a dig at four-time former Chief Minister and Politburo member Manik Sarkar, he said that Narendra Modi has created such a situation in the country that former Chief Minister and Politburo member Manik Sarkar is deviant and asking to vote for Congress candidate Ashish Kumar Saha. The state BJP president said that nothing could be more unfortunate than this. In the press conference, he said that there has not been a single political murder after 2018. But during the Communist regime, Minister Bimal Sinha, MLA Parimal Saha and MLA Madhusudan Saha were murdered. And they were all brutally murdered by the Communists’ murderous forces. Even before 2018, 11 BJP workers were killed. Brings down attacks on many functions. Rajib Bhattacharjee  expressed the opinion that the people of the state rejected them. Minister Pranajit Singh Roy, state BJP spokesperson Subrata Chakraborty and others were also present in the press conference organized.
